Manokotak Man Faces Charges for Allegedly Sexually Assaulting Minor

A 36 year old Manokotak man is facing charges for allegedly sexually assaulting a 15 year old girl.  At 6 a.m. Wednesday morning, troopers received a report that Robert Geerhart Junior had become highly intoxicated after drinking R&R whisky. 

Around 3 or 4 a.m. he allegedly left his house and went to a tent in the yard where 7 girls, including his 5 daughters, were camping.  Troopers say he began having sex with the victim, one of his daughters’ friends.

One of the other girls woke up, saw the assault taking place, and ran from the tent to find help.  Geerhart Junior then left the tent and went back into his house.

According to the complaint, two VPSOs had attempted to get reach Geerhart, who was in a skiff on the Weary river and would not come ashore.  He allegedly had a scoped rifle in the bow.  He eventually came ashore and was taken into custody Wednesday. He was in Dillingham court for his first felony first appearance Thursday. A pre-arraignment hearing is scheduled for next Friday (June 21).
